Good morning, students, and welcome to the university. I’d like to begin with some information about graduate student housing, and then I’ll turn this session over to Dr. Paulson, who will explain some of the financial support services we offer to graduate students.
First of all, I hope you have a smooth time getting settled here. I know that finding housing is often difficult. So let me give you some information that might help you. I know that several of you have already moved into our new graduate student unit. It’s located on the west side of the campus. In this building, four students share dining and living rooms, kitchen, two bathrooms, and four single bedrooms. We do have a few more empty rooms, so if you’re interested in moving in, let me know right away.
If you haven’t visited the family student housing complex, be sure to go take a look at it. This small community has two-bedroom unfurnished apartments. They’re on the south side of campus, near the downtown bus stop. Unfortunately, all apartments are full now, and we have a waiting list for next year. Come to see me if you want to add your name to the list. You should apply as soon as possible for next year.
If you want to live off campus and are still looking for a house, be sure to check out the Off-campus Housing Office. You’ll find a lot of rentals listed there.
Now let me turn this over to Dr. Paulson. He will explain some things about the financial aid program.
